Arifpur is a village in Ghaziabad Tehsil of Ghaziabad district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 119757.

About Arifpur village record

The source record places Arifpur in Ghaziabad Tehsil of Ghaziabad district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 119757.

The Census 2011 record reports population 128, 21 households, area 117.40 hectares.
